PVD Devices

We design and build custom devices for the physical vapor deposition (PVD) methods sputtering and cathodic arc deposition (CAD).

Here are examples of PVD devices we have been built:
Combined CAD and PECVD device to coat profiles for bath shower stalls with hard chromium
Combined CAD and PECVD device to coat profiles for bath shower stalls with hard chromium. The profiles are activated, subsequently coated with chromium and eventually coated with a plasma polymer as finish. All process steps are performed in the same chamber without any transfers.
Diode sputtering device
Special device for DC diode sputtering. This sputtering method allows the deposition of electrically conductive coatings that have different properties than magnetron sputtered coatings.
Dual magnetron sputter device
Sputter device with a dual magnetron. It allows to sputter two materials at once. The device is used for R&D at the Brandenburg University of Technology Cottbus-Senftenberg.
Electron beam sputter device
Sputter device where an electron beam is used to evaporate the material that will be used for the coating.
